Szpakowska et al. also examined conolidone and its motion to the ACKR3 receptor, which allows to elucidate its Earlier unidentified system of motion in both of those acute and chronic pain control (fifty eight). It was observed that receptor amounts of ACKR3 were as high as well as greater as those in the Conolidine alkaloid for chronic pain endogenous opiate procedure and were correlated to related parts of the CNS. This receptor was also not modulated by typical opiate agonists, which includes morphine, fentanyl, buprenorphine, or antagonists like naloxone. In a very rat design, it had been identified that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ory action, leading to an General increase in opiate receptor activity.

We demonstrated that, in distinction to classical opioid receptors, ACKR3 will not trigger classical G protein signaling and isn't modulated with the classical prescription or analgesic opioids, like mor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ists including naloxone. Alternatively, we established that LIH383, an ACKR3-selective subnanomolar competitor peptide, prevents ACKR3’s unfavorable regulatory perform on opioid peptides within an ex vivo rat Mind design and potentiates their exercise towards classical opioid receptors.

Gene expression analysis exposed that ACKR3 is highly expressed in numerous Mind regions corresponding to important opioid exercise facilities. Moreover, its expression stages are often greater than Individuals of classical opioid receptors, which even further supports the physiological relevance of its noticed in vitro opioid peptide scavenging ability.
